选择嵌入式分析提供商的五个最佳实践

越来越多的用户都期望在企业应用程序中嵌入数据分析和可视化。然而并非所有的分析平台都可以直接嵌入到其他应用之中。企业应用的技术产品经理应使用本文介绍的最佳实践,选择合适的嵌入式数据分析提供商。

摘要

关键挑战

  1. 许多企业应用程序提供商尝试自行构建分析程序,而不考虑外包给嵌入式分析程序提供商的选项,这可能会影响产品上市时间。
  2. 软件提供商提供的独立运行的数据分析产品,主要销售给最终用户,通常没有针对嵌入到其他企业应用程序的场景进行设计或优化。
  3. 嵌入式分析解决方案的外观可能直接影响企业应用程序的整体印象和客户体验。
  4. 最终用户倾向于选择提供嵌入式机器学习的企业应用程序,而不是仅提供基本报告和仪表板的企业应用程序。

建议

技术产品经理在构建和营销企业应用程序时,应当遵循以下建议:

  1. 通过了解谁是应用程序的用户,以及他们需要做出哪些决策,将嵌入式分析功能与用户需求和技能相匹配。
  2. 优先考虑采用那种能够实现无缝集成的嵌入式数据分析产品,即确保从外观和交互体验都是一个应用程序的感觉,而不是能够看出是两个不同应用的体验。
  3. 不要局限于可视化,要对分析平台与您的应用程序的集成程度进行基准测试,以评估分析平台的功能。
  4. 添加机器学习功能以提高自动化程度并增强决策能力。 寻找可在整个数据和分析管道中结合机器学习的平台,以加快获取商业洞察的时间,从而为用户提供上下文相关的建议以指导决策。
  5. 寻找与您文化背景相似、并且积极促成您的嵌入式分析计划成功的供应商。

 

预测

到2020年,80%的企业应用程序供应商将在其解决方案中提供的高级分析技术方面展开竞争。

概述

在过去的二十年中,企业应用程序提供商往往将数据分析视为可有可无、有了更好的功能,这种分析功能通常是由分析合作伙伴提供,作为企业应用的附加功能。这种情况已经改变。企业软件提供商需要认识到,最终用户组织已经在评估供应商的分析能力,而不仅是核心功能。促成这种变化的原因包括:数据的爆炸性增长,内置分析功能的消费者应用无处不在,以及数字业务初创企业对成熟行业的冲击。事实上,Gartner预测,到2020年,大多数企业应用程序提供商将在产品提供的高级分析能力水平方面进行竞争,而不仅仅是核心功能的比拼。

 

定义:嵌入式分析软件是一种将实时报表,交互式数据可视化和/或高级分析(包括机器学习)直接提供给企业业务应用程序的软件。 数据由分析平台管理,可视化图表和报表直接集成到应用程序用户界面上,为商业用户提供更好的数据相关性和可用性。

 

但是,并非所有分析产品都是可嵌入式的设计。有些软件厂商试图提供那种面向直销客户的嵌入式分析产品,但是实际上缺少真正的满足嵌入式体验的功能。最新的嵌入式数据分析平台不再只是提供一组功能单一的工具,而是支持完整的集成分析功能技术栈——从报表与仪表板到自助式分析、业务预警、协作,直至数据准备和机器学习。这些功能建立在一个统一的、可伸缩的架构中,辅以常用的维护和管理功能。此外,这些功能一开始就是专为Web、云和移动交付而设计的。这种嵌入式分析平台还将更便于开发人员创建定制化的数据分析应用程序。

在选择要嵌入到应用程序中的分析工具之前,有许多因素需要考虑。 有技术方面的因素(例如分析功能,API和架构),也有业务方面的因素(例如定价,支持和服务)。 图1所列为企业应用程序提供商在选择嵌入式分析平台提供商时需要考虑的八个主要因素。

选择BI工具的8个因素

 

当今的市场上,有很多嵌入式数据分析供应商可供选择,这些技术供应商可大致归为三类(分类下的典型供应商名录是不完全统计):

  1. 专业分析厂商:专门致力于向独立软件供应商(ISV)和构建应用程序的最终用户出售嵌入式分析程序的提供商。 典型供应商包括:Exago, GoodData, Jinfonet Software, Izenda, Logi Analytics and TIBCO Software (Jaspersoft)
  2. 主营分析厂商:嵌入式分析产品收入占总业务收入比例较大(超过25%)的供应商。典型供应商包括:Birst, ClearStory Data, Looker, Sisense and Yellowfin
  3. 次营分析厂商:嵌入式分析产品收入占总业务收入比例较小(低于25%)、产品设计主要面向最终用户的供应商。产品不一定为支持嵌入式分析做了特别修改。典型供应商包括:Information Builders, MicroStrategy, Pentaho and Qlik

 

分析

将嵌入式分析功能与用户需求和技能相匹配

了解谁将成为嵌入式分析的用户,以及他们需要回答的业务问题。 这需要分析用户角色并映射其信息工作流程,以确定每个人如何以及何时消费信息。大多数用户都可以归为四个主要角色:

  1. 运营用户:通常是一线工作人员,他们需要高度上下文相关的分析和建议,通常是业务工作流中任务的一部分。
  2. 随机分析用户:这类用户需要查看报表或仪表板,往往需要通过一个非预设的数据过滤器,浏览特定数据。这类用户越来越需要分析工具能够自动查找数据模式并提供业务建议。
  3. 超级用户:这类用户精通数据,并希望完全灵活地组合不同的数据源,创建自己的可视化图表,并与数据进行交互。
  4. 管理员:负责管理角色和权限的人员。经常帮助部署新的数据源,根据需要创建报表或仪表板,还要负责管理分析平台。

为了最大程度地减少培训需求并提高可用性和采用率,请考虑为用户角色匹配和调整分析的方法。 换句话说,不要让用户花费宝贵的时间来适应和学习嵌入式分析工具。

 

优先考虑能够无缝集成的嵌入式方案

用户体验很重要。要寻找的嵌入式数据分析平台,不仅要支持图表和可视化元素的嵌入,而且要更加深入,将数据和分析结果集成到应用程序的结构之中。这种“无缝”的方式意味着用户甚至都不知道他们正在使用多产品应用程序。允许用户从应用程序内部立即采取行动,而无需切换。另一个要点是:能够将分析直接集成到工作流中,在执行应用程序中的特定任务时,可以在受影响的流程节点提供更多上下文相关的业务洞察。

可视化也很重要。 要选择用户界面外观更加现代的平台。如果嵌入的可视化效果和图表是很陈旧的外观,用户肯定会注意到的。无缝的体验还意味着,图表和图形是响应式的,用户通过筛选数据或向下钻取的方式与应用程序交互时,图形图表应动态更新。要了解分析功能如何集成到应用程序的菜单、按钮、选项卡和其他屏幕中。还要选择一个这样的平台,该平台应可将用户界面重新设计,使其外观和感觉就像您自己的应用程序一样。要考虑使用机器学习来提供预测性和规范性分析的更现代的嵌入式分析平台。这样的平台可以使得用户更容易地看到数据中的模式和规律,并提供业务建议,从而改善体验。

 

超越可视化来评估基础平台的应用集成

避免将注意力集中在为用户提供优雅的可视化效果上。您不会想在选择一个平台之后便意识到该软件缺少后端,无法以一种可以插入应用程序的格式来获取数据。或者,它可能缺乏安全模型来限制哪些用户角色可以查看特定数据。了解嵌入式分析平台的局限性的最简单方法是请求概念证明而不是演示。 使用您自己的数据(而不是产品示例数据)来评估,看看该工具通过可用的交互式数据,将分析功能嵌入到应用程序的用户界面,准确度和速度到底如何。

在评估嵌入式平台提供商时,请务必考虑以下方面:

  1. 可伸缩性。优先考虑可以随您的需求(和您的客户的需求)增长而扩展,处理越来越多数据的平台。使用一个对数据或用户数量有限制的嵌入式解决方案,最终会限制应用程序自身的增长,并带给最终用户一种运行缓慢、容量有限的体验。
  2. 集成。寻找真正可以与您的应用程序集成、提供丰富的API来集成可视化,传递数据和处理安全性的平台。 一些提供商声称提供嵌入式分析,但是使用一种称为“ iframe”的技术,该技术本质上将分析与主机应用程序交织在一起。 由于用户与应用程序交互时图形和图表并非响应式的,因此这不是真正的嵌入。
  3. 安全性。身份验证和访问控制是嵌入式分析的关键问题。 要选择一个能够与应用程序的安全模型配合使用的分析平台,例如单点登录,LDAP或微软活动目录。 另外,请确保可以将应用程序中建立的角色和权限传递给嵌入式分析平台,以确保为用户授予适当的访问权限。这种权限控制应涵盖对分析功能的访问,例如图表、报表和仪表板以及数据(包括数据源、表、列和行)。
  4. 数据架构。要了解平台如何访问数据,因为这会影响性能。 一些平台查询后端数据源,并即时连接和转换数据,而无需在本地持久化数据。 其他平台则仅在将数据提取并加载到内存数据库后才查询数据。 选择一个在可伸缩性和性能之间达到最佳平衡的提供商。
  5. 部署。 如果您的应用程序是基于云的,那么您应该优先考虑已构建为可以在云中运行的分析平台。 有些以全云SaaS或PaaS产品的形式运行,而其他一些则只是将本地部署的软件经过裁剪后部署在云中。如果您的应用程序既可本地部署也可云中部署,请选择提供相同部署选项的分析平台。

 

添加机器学习功能以提高自动化程度并增强决策能力

Gartner将那种引入机器学习特征的嵌入式高级功能称为“增强分析”。这个概念的核心是使用机器学习自动化来增强人类智能并提高整个数据和分析工作流程中的上下文感知——从数据到洞察,再到行动。它不仅加快了业务洞察的交付速度,而且还有助于减少决策偏见。 业务用户使用嵌入式高级分析工具,无需掌握数据科学技能即可执行复杂的分析,这意味着业务用户可以制定更好、更快的决策。

基于机器学习的嵌入式分析可以使您的应用程序更加普及,并对更加广泛的用户群体提供帮助。 机器学习可以提升嵌入式分析价值的领域包括:

  1. 数据准备—自动收集、清理和合并不同来源的数据,特别是针对更多随机分析的业务用户。
  2. 自然语言界面—为用户提供语音或聊天等替代方式与您的应用程序交互。
  3. 自动异常值检测—自动发现例外情况和异常事件,并将结果呈现给用户或自动触发某个操作。
  4. 建议—为用户提供指导性建议,推荐下一步行动。
  5. 因果关系和重要性检测—确定影响某些指标的关键因素,例如盈利能力,或哪些因素在推动销售增长。

 

要咨询分析提供商,他们目前在平台中提供了哪些机器学习功能,将来的产品路线图中会添加哪些其他的高级分析功能。 确定是否需要自己构建和管理模型。 如果嵌入式提供商提供了预打包的模型,那就咨询有哪些可用的训练数据,因为大多数模型都需要训练才能提供精确的结果。

 

寻找文化背景相似并且积极促成嵌入式分析成功的供应商

不要只评估嵌入式分析产品的功能,而要评估产品提供商本身。您需要一个可以信任、并且有动机确保您的嵌入式分析计划获得成功的提供商作为您的合作伙伴。您的应用程序团队和分析提供商需要共同努力,以建立所需的集成,就未来的产品增强进行协作,并解决可能出现的任何客户支持问题。一旦将分析功能嵌入到您的应用程序,此后再换到另一个提供商,将是一个巨大的工作量。如果提供商在评估和谈判过程中不够灵活且难以合作,那可能是一个警告信号,一旦您签署合同,很可能会合作困难并且提供商不会发自内心地急您所急。

专门销售嵌入式分析产品、或者很大一部分收入来自嵌入式分析产品的提供商,通常会更加了解确保应用程序成功所需的条件。他们具有专门的工程和服务支持,可帮助您将分析功能集成并嵌入到您的应用程序中。要寻找这种可提供工程和集成支持的提供商,因为嵌入式产品与出售给直接客户内部使用的独立产品不同,通常会使用不同的API,并且需要重新包装和本地化。

与面向直销客户相比,嵌入式分析产品的定价和授权模式也需要有所不同。基于用户数量的永久和订阅许可,这种标准的授权模式在嵌入式分析世界中很难适用。这是因为应用程序提供商很难预先估计用户数量并跟踪使用情况。理想情况下,您需要一种嵌入式定价指标,该指标应与您的授权销售模式保持一致。例如,当您按用户数销售自己的应用程序时,不会希望分析工具提供商按所分析的数据量或CPU核数来定价。为了计算付给分析工具的版税,这种定价方式的差异对跟踪用户的使用情况是一个很大的挑战,并且按分析数据量计费也相当于不鼓励用户更多地使用分析功能。最好协商一种固定费用与期限(例如三到五年)的无限制授权。

 

案例研究

Access公司

Access开发了电子表单管理(EFM)软件,该软件消除了纸质表单的费用、风险和低效。 据Access称,其解决方案使组织能够在不使用纸张、打印机或扫描仪的情况下,获取、管理、签发表单,并与其他系统共享电子表单和数据。员工可以随时随地、使用任何设备,与无纸化电子表单进行交互。

使用Access的客户开始要求提供报表功能。 用户想要一种可以链接到不同数据源(例如电子病历,ERP和CRM),将数据汇总并转储到数据库中,然后基于这些数据制作报表的解决方案。 最初,Access构建并提供了自己的报表解决方案,但是在用户开始要求仪表板和其他商业智能功能之后,该公司决定嵌入第三方的分析解决方案。 Access的理念是,嵌入式分析解决方案必须使其客户能够自给自足,并赋予他们灵活性。如果用户之前已经使用了其他商品化的分析软件,这种灵活性要足以弥补第三方分析工具本身的不足。

对于Access,其选择标准不仅基于嵌入式产品功能,还基于提供商的文化。 考虑到为客户提供出色的分析体验的重要性日益增长,Access希望找到一个战略合作伙伴。 在评估了六个候选的分析解决方案之后,Access选择了Izenda作为其嵌入式分析工具提供商。 Access喜欢Izenda仅与OEM和增值经销商合作,这与许多其他分析供应商不同,后者的核心业务是出售给最终用户组织供内部使用。 Access认为,专注OEM公司更加专注于ISV的成功。

 

Iconixx公司

Iconixx的总部位于德克萨斯州奥斯汀,提供基于云的企业销售绩效管理软件解决方案,使组织可以根据销售执行情况调整企业战略和计划。根据Iconixx的介绍,其解决方案可提高运营效率,以多种货币提供佣金支付的准确性,计划建模和优化,销售业绩指标和地区管理,可靠的预测,高级分析和法规遵从性。 Iconixx通过自动化,分析和优化佣金和激励流程,帮助组织更有效地进行预算和计划,提高销售生产率并提高整体盈利能力。

Iconixx仅提供产品首次发布时已在内部构建的基本分析功能。客户开始要求更多的分析洞察和更好的可视化效果。Iconixx并未继续自己构建分析,而是决定研究可以嵌入的第三方分析解决方案。在对不同供应商进行详尽评估之后,Iconixx选择了Logi Analytics作为其嵌入式提供商。对于Iconixx而言,分析解决方案与应用程序之间的集成体验,比简单的为分析界面贴上标签和打上Logo更为重要。Iconixx排除了云托管选项,因为出于安全考虑,它希望在本地运行分析。Logi的嵌入式分析许可模式也很有吸引力,因为入门级价格非常适合Iconixx这样的小型企业。

 

Kyruus公司

总部位于波士顿的Kyruus提供搜索和日程安排软件,可帮助医院和保健机构为患者匹配最合适的医护人员。据Kyruus称,其ProviderMatch患者访问平台可在多个访问点实现一致的患者体验,同时使医护的供应与患者的需求保持一致。

Kyruus很早就意识到,在ProviderMatch中提供嵌入式分析,是一个很好的机会,客户的反馈加强了这种需求。Kyruus最初开始自行构建分析功能。但是,作为一家早期公司,Kyruus很快意识到它缺乏内部构建和维护分析功能的资源。此外,报表和可视化已成为一种通用性商品,并不是其开发人员的核心专业知识。虽然他们在内部已经使用了多种业界领先的可视化工具,但是这些工具的功能太多,对用户来说增加了复杂性。另外,作为嵌入式分析工具,还需要后端数据准备功能。

Kyruus对数家嵌入式分析专业厂商进行了评估,最终选择了GoodData。GoodData分析可部署为云服务,也可以嵌入到业务流程中,还可以用作独立的临时分析。GoodData UI外观和感觉就像Kyruus自己的软件一样,这是选择GoodData的另一个原因。

 

依据

本文基于对十几家企业应用软件厂商的背景调查和直接访问。他们都提供嵌入式数据分析功能。他们都分析过外采与构建这两种实现策略的优劣,并且在嵌入式分析产品选型阶段,他们都评估过多个嵌入式分析工具厂商。

原文地址:

https://www.gartner.com/doc/reprints?id=1-6NBDI6K&ct=190508

  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值